Oculus VR Headsets

Oculus is a VR headset company that was founded in 2012. The company is owned by Facebook.

The company's first product was the Oculus Rift, which was released in 2016. The Rift is a VR headset that allows users to experience virtual reality. The headset comes with a controller that allows users to interact with the VR environment. The Rift has a resolution of 1080x1200 pixels per eye and a 90 Hz refresh rate.

The company's second product is the Oculus Quest, which was released in 2019. The Quest is a standalone VR headset that does not require a PC to run. The Quest has a resolution of 1600x1440 pixels per eye and a 72 Hz refresh rate. The Quest also comes with two controllers that allow users to interact with the VR environment.

The company's third product is the Oculus Go, which was released in 2018. The Go is a standalone VR headset that does not require a PC to run. The Go has a resolution of 1280x1440 pixels per eye and a 60 Hz refresh rate. The Go comes with a single controller that allows users to interact with the VR environment.

Oculus has a few major competitors, such as HTC, Sony, and Microsoft. Oculus is one of the leading VR headset companies and is constantly innovating to bring new and improved VR experiences to users.
